Quick answer: UV filters absorb or reflect UV. Korea approves several elegant next-generation filters not yet available in the US, a key reason Korean sunscreens feel so light.

Why is Korean sunscreen considered better?

Korean sunscreens are often praised for elegant, lightweight textures that feel pleasant enough to wear daily, which encourages consistent use. They frequently use newer filters approved in Korea but not the US. Preferences are partly cosmetic; effectiveness depends on applying enough and reapplying regardless of brand.

Why is Korean sunscreen better?

Because Korea approves modern UV filters — Uvinul A Plus, Tinosorb S and M among them — that give strong UVA protection in light, non-greasy textures. Some markets, notably the US, have not approved them.
